Output 391f4b9bc09f32f3d68f1484ae5fb3a281b5fb9b972162fddb09789a853ac27c:17

value
318152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8fb9906265756167d2176544ccc18f6cbdac03c OP_EQUAL
address
3L1iUEBBftiMjnR2VYjM5NyssKfhejVcym
transaction
391f4b9bc09f32f3d68f1484ae5fb3a281b5fb9b972162fddb09789a853ac27c
confirmations
187407
spent
true